23.10.2008 - Ukraine's currency reserves down almost 8%
From Istockanalyst.com: The currency reserves of the National Bank of Ukraine fell by 7.7% in October (by $2.9 billion), reaching $34.6 billion, Ukrainian President Viktor Yushchenko said. The bank reserves will be enough to repay $8.8 billion worth of foreign debts of banks and companies in the fourth quarter of this year, but their replenishment using an IMF loan will have a psychological effect on the market, said the president.....
